Conference Revolves on the Spin

It all revolved around physics: Researchers from over 25 countries met at the JKU to discuss new developments in spin physics.

The five-day, bi-annual conference included discussions about base-knowledge physics, nanotechnology, information technology, and materials sciences. In addition, participants discussed the latest findings and future research and applications. Away from the conference rooms, participants enjoyed an outing to the St. Florian Abbey, learning more about Austria’s rich cultural traditions and history.

The "10th International School and Conference on the Physics and Applications of Spin Phenomena in Solids – PASPS10" was organized by the Department of Solid State Physicis (under the direction of: Univ. Prof. Alberta Bonanni).
